Importance of Health Testing
When looking for health tested doodles, it is essential to understand why health testing is important. Health testing helps to identify genetic conditions that may affect the dog’s quality of life. Common issues in doodles can include hip dysplasia, eye disorders, and certain skin conditions. By choosing a breeder who conducts health tests, you are more likely to bring home a dog that is free from these genetic issues, ensuring a healthier and happier companion.
- Look for breeders who are members of recognized breed clubs or organizations. These breeders often adhere to higher standards of breeding practices.
- Ask for health clearances and documentation. A reputable breeder will provide proof of health testing for the parent dogs.
- Read reviews and testimonials from previous clients. This can give you insight into the breeder's reputation and the health of their puppies.
Visiting Breeders
What to Look For
Once you have narrowed down your list of potential breeders, it’s time to visit them. In-person visits allow you to assess the conditions in which the puppies are raised and the breeder’s commitment to health testing.
- Observe the living conditions of the dogs. Ensure they are clean, spacious, and provide a nurturing environment.
- Meet the puppies’ parents. This will give you an idea of their temperament and health. Healthy parents often indicate healthy puppies.
- Ask the breeder about their breeding practices. A responsible breeder will be transparent about their methods and the health tests conducted.
- Inquire about the socialization process of the puppies. Well-socialized puppies are more likely to adapt well to their new homes.
Final Considerations
When you find a breeder who meets your criteria and provides health tested doodles, it’s important to consider the overall fit for your family. Doodles come in various sizes and temperaments, so understanding the specific needs and characteristics of the breed mix is essential.
Before making a final decision, think about:
- Your lifestyle and activity level. Some doodles require more exercise and mental stimulation than others.
- Any allergies within your household. While doodles are often hypoallergenic, individual reactions can vary.
- The long-term commitment of owning a dog, including grooming, training, and healthcare.
